Flaps are secondary carton elements, hinge-connected along a free edge of a panel or another flap. Example: A simple four-sided tray with a tuck end closure top and bottom includes a glue flap attached to the free edge of the rear panel, dust flaps attached to upper and lower free edges of the left and right side panels, and tuck flaps ... flowers to cover fence https://digiest-media.com

WebFull Overlap Seal End (FOSE) This carton is generally assembled, filled and sealed on automatic, horizontal or vertical packaging equipment. The usual sequence for closure, as indicated in Fig. 2, is dust flaps in first, followed by the inner closure panels (swinging from the rear panel) and finally the outer closure panels (swinging from the front panel). Description: Component Parts and Detailing for a Tube. … WebSeal Ends have dust flaps that are usually sandwiched in-between the internal and external flaps located at the bottom of the box, although sometimes the dust flap is placed below both. This bottom trifecta is where Seal End cartons get their name, and is the gold-standard for cereal packaging. Tray Style

WebA carton has side and bottom walls of generally rectangular configuration, a pair of dust flaps hinged for closure on opposed side walls, and a pair of closure flaps hinged on opposed walls perpendicular to the first, for closure over the dust flaps. The dust flaps are constructed and arranged to be hinged inwardly of the carton and include cut-out sections …
